A review of the information and <br />drawings provided on May 14, 2014, shows the proposed work is to impact 0.17 acres <br />of surface waters for the installation of 200 linear feet of 84 inch reinforced concrete <br />pipe (RCP) and 72 linear feet of a 60 inch RCP in the Indian River Farms Water Control <br />District (IRFWCD) Sub -Lateral B-8 Canal. The project also involves the installation of <br />0.17 acre of rock rip rap in the IRFWCD Canal on the east side of 58th Avenue, north <br />and south of 13th Street SW, as reflected in the attached exhibits. The project is located <br />off of 13th Street SW and 58th Avenue, and is associated with the replacement of an <br />existing bridge over the IRFWCD Canal at the intersection of 13th Street SW and 58th <br />Avenue, in Vero Beach, in Section 28, Township 33 South, Range 39 East in Indian <br />River County, Florida. <br />Your project, as depicted on the enclosed drawings, is authorized by Nationwide <br />Permit (NWP) Numbers 13 and 14. In addition, project specific conditions have been <br />enclosed. This verification is valid until March 18, 2017. Furthermore, if you <br />commence or are under contract to commence this activity before the date that the <br />relevant nationwide permit is modified or revoked, you will have 12 months from the <br />date of the modification or revocation of the NWP to complete the activity under the <br />present terms and conditions of this nationwide permit.
